How can post-termination exercise periods impact the value of cryptocurrency options?

These periods refer to the time frame after an employee leaves a company but still has the option to exercise their vested stock options. In the context of cryptocurrency options, this means that even after leaving a project or company, individuals may still have the opportunity to exercise their options and potentially profit from the value appreciation of the underlying cryptocurrency. This can create additional liquidity in the market and potentially affect the supply and demand dynamics, which in turn can impact the value of the options.

On one hand, they provide individuals with the opportunity to continue participating in the potential upside of a cryptocurrency project even after leaving the company. On the other hand, these exercise periods can also lead to increased selling pressure as employees cash out their options, potentially driving down the value of the underlying cryptocurrency. It's important for investors to consider the potential impact of post-termination exercise periods when evaluating the value of cryptocurrency options.
